How much do sql server support eng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for sql server support engineer in the United States is $101,706.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,500.00 and $117,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a SQL Server Support Engineer do?

A SQL Server Support Engineer is responsible for diagnosing, troubleshooting, and resolving issues related to Microsoft SQL Server databases. They assist clients and internal teams with database performance, security, configuration, backups, and data recovery. Their work ensures databases run smoothly, efficiently, and securely, minimizing downtime and data loss. They may also provide guidance on best practices, migrations, and upgrades to help organizations maintain robust and optimized SQL Server environments.

What is the difference between Sql Server Support Engineer vs Database Administrator?

AspectSql Server Support EngineerDatabase Administrator
CertificationsMicrosoft Certified: Azure Database Administrator Associate, MCSA SQL ServerMicrosoft Certified: Azure Database Administrator Associate, MCDBA
Work EnvironmentTechnical support, troubleshooting, incident resolutionDatabase management, performance tuning, backups
Employer & IndustryIT support firms, tech companies, enterprise IT departmentsFinancial, healthcare, retail, enterprise sectors

While both roles involve working with SQL Server, a Sql Server Support Engineer primarily focuses on troubleshooting, supporting, and resolving technical issues related to SQL Server environments. In contrast, a Database Administrator manages the overall database health, performance, and security. The roles often overlap but differ mainly in scope: support vs. management.
